A motorcyclist has suffered serious leg injuries following a crash in Kwinana.
Police say a gold Holden Senator HSV sedan and a black Harley Davidson motorcycle, collided at the intersection of Mason and Donaldson Roads around 4.40pm on Thursday.
The 53-year-old male rider was airlifted to Royal Perth Hospital.
The 32-year-old male driver of the Holden was not injured.
